RE: Liberty Forces Message dump - Toaster - 04-15-2020 - - - - - INCOMING SECONDARY FLEET TRANSMISSION - - - - -
COMM ID: Captain Edmund Mallory
TARGET ID: Liberty Navy Report Center
SUBJECT: Nomad Vagrant presence in the New York system
ENCRYPTION: HIGH
PRIORITY: HIGH
This is Captain Edmund Mallory of the naval training ship LNS Sierra Nevada.
At 1621 hours SMT, our scanners again picked up a Nomad signature near Fort Bush and Baltimore Shipyard. The readouts indicated that it may have been the same vessel that we encountered two days ago (Vagrant.Aun'el). The Nomad rapidly approached the Sierra Nevada and the stations, seemingly trying to communicate with my bridge crew and me. I transmitted a warning to stay clear of the stations and had our weapon systems warmed up. The warning, however, was ignored.
Instead, it seemed to... transmit some sort of vision at us. It affected both myself and the rest of the officers on the bridge at the time. Images of some sort of alien city and other... structures that I can't exactly describe. It was also making my crew feel strangely calm and friendly towards the Nomad. I have to admit, I was barely able to resist this attack myself. Just when an image of the alien appeared seemingly right in front of me, I was able to snap out of it and take manual control of the weapon systems. Immediately upon being fired upon, it cut the visions and jumped through a hyperspace breach. My crew recovered pretty much immediately, though a few officers are still complaining about images briefly flashing up before them. I will have them all submit to a medical and psych exam as well as myself, just to be on the safe side. Scans of the Nomad vessel and the communications log will be attached below. RE: Liberty Forces Message dump - Kelby - 04-18-2020 - - - - - INCOMING TRANSMISSION - - - - -
Image feed online COMM ID: Cadet Marcus Carter
TARGET ID: Liberty Report Center
SUBJECT: Field report
ENCRYPTION: High
PRIORITY: High
This is Cadet Marcus Carter, my today's report is about an encounter with two Rogue gunboats that happened two days ago. I began my patrol in New York system at 2000 Hours SMT. Not before long I received an order to pursue two Rogue gunboats, which were spotted near Fort Bush. After a short chase through Colorado and Ontario, the hostile vessels were intercepted in Sierra Ice Field, in California system. Right after that the hostile vessels turned around and opened fire at me and Lieutenant Commander Jeremiah Sawyer, who was there with me on LNS-Monitor. Our forces responded in kind and without hesitation. At the start, the fight did not go well for us, for we did not have enough fire power that would match the two gunboats. Fortunately, after some time two other Liberty Navy vessels joined the fight and turned the tide of battle in our favor. I managed to destroy one of the gunboats with a lucky shot from my antimatter cannon when his shields were depleted and his hull was severly damaged. Then Lieutenant Commander Jeremiah Sawyer ordered us not to attack the other gunboat, because he wanted to deal with it personally. It did not take long and the other gunboat was destroyed by Lieutenant Commander Jeremiah Sawyer. RE: Liberty Forces Message dump - bakugone - 04-25-2020 - - - - - INCOMING TRANSMISSION - - - - -
Image feed online COMM ID: Captain Marcus Robinson
TARGET ID: Liberty Navy Reporting Center
SUBJECT: Nomad Attack report
ENCRYPTION: Medium
PRIORITY: Medium
Captain Marcus Robinson signing on the report.
Today at 1812 hours, Carrier Nevada under my command engaged Nomad warforms in the New York system.
At first - like normally I do, I read reports and at that time I received reports in my quarters that an Nomad Incursion have taken place at the Planet Manhattan - being cornered about safety of the civilian life's I took command of the Carrier Nevada and joined up with the Carrier Bennington and Liberty Dreadnought Arkansas at West Point Academy - from there our warships took tradelane to Planet Manhattan. When we arrived, we detected at least four nomad warforms eager to engage our Liberty warships. Friendly squadron of our own and enemy fighters was already engaging each other nearby before we arrived and so we supported them morally too. The nomad warforms met the Liberty wrath from Nevada, Arkansas and Bennington guns while they were pounded by the "Collapser"-class Primary turrets. In the end, Nevada destroyed two Nomad warforms - as for Arkansas and Bennington, per one. Shortly after we defeated enemy warforms, our fighters cleared remaining hostile fighters and gunboats - Nevada, Arkansas received moderate damage because of the debris which hit both of our ships, however Bennington received medium damage over the battle and returned to Norfolk Shipyard for repairs. After pilots were accounted for - Nevada returned to Norfolk Shipyard for the maintenance This is all.
